Architectural CEU

One of the tasks that has been assigned to the architectural profession is further education. Yes, after all those years of studying and countless hours in the studio drawing and cutting and pasting, and don't forget the 4 days straight taking the 12 part licensing exam.....ok maybe that was just me and was some time ago. (all you guys taking the tests now have it much easier....trust me!)

State requires us to continue our education by participating in seminars and/or informational sessions.  Our office does its best to promote these by having luncheons in our office allowing the vendors to present relative education seminars to the office staff but also obtain design information and details on projects that we are currently active in.

Today we get to listen to ERCO lighting as they share their knowledge on LED lighting. Brought to us by our friends at Lighting of Virginia.

Last week we were able to hear more about sustainability utilizing concrete panel systems from Nichiha. Both valuable information for our current design projects.
